diff --git a/src-tauri/icons/icon.icns b/src-tauri/icons/icon.icns index c3721c3f..227dff62 100644 Binary files a/src-tauri/icons/icon.icns and b/src-tauri/icons/icon.icns differ diff --git a/src-web/components/RequestPane.tsx b/src-web/components/RequestPane.tsx index 06c1cc5d..064a2912 100644 --- a/src-web/components/RequestPane.tsx +++ b/src-web/components/RequestPane.tsx @@ -55,7 +55,7 @@ export function RequestPane({ fullHeight, className }: Props) { defaultValue="body" label="Request body" > - + - setViewMode((m) => (m === 'pretty' ? 'raw' : 'pretty'))} - /> setViewMode((m) => (m === 'pretty' ? 'raw' : 'pretty')), + }, + '-----', { label: 'Clear Response', onSelect: deleteResponse.mutate, @@ -100,7 +98,7 @@ export const ResponsePane = memo(function ResponsePane({ className }: Props) { diff --git a/src-web/components/Workspace.tsx b/src-web/components/Workspace.tsx index af95fa40..1d2d007c 100644 --- a/src-web/components/Workspace.tsx +++ b/src-web/components/Workspace.tsx @@ -53,6 +53,7 @@ export default function Workspace() { {activeRequest?.name}
+
diff --git a/src-web/components/core/Icon.tsx b/src-web/components/core/Icon.tsx index d800d6e8..ae58ae0e 100644 --- a/src-web/components/core/Icon.tsx +++ b/src-web/components/core/Icon.tsx @@ -23,6 +23,7 @@ import { UpdateIcon, RowsIcon, MagicWandIcon, + MagnifyingGlassIcon, } from '@radix-ui/react-icons'; import classnames from 'classnames'; @@ -50,7 +51,9 @@ const icons = { triangleRight: TriangleRightIcon, update: UpdateIcon, magicWand: MagicWandIcon, + magnifyingGlass: MagnifyingGlassIcon, x: Cross2Icon, + empty: () => , }; export interface IconProps { diff --git a/src-web/components/core/IconButton.tsx b/src-web/components/core/IconButton.tsx index 6b46d3c0..069bd001 100644 --- a/src-web/components/core/IconButton.tsx +++ b/src-web/components/core/IconButton.tsx @@ -22,6 +22,7 @@ export const IconButton = forwardRef(function IconButt onClick, className, iconClassName, + tabIndex, size = 'md', iconSize, ...props @@ -32,6 +33,9 @@ export const IconButton = forwardRef(function IconButt return (